DAMAI I was built in Tanjung Bira, South Sulawesi, by Pak Hadji Baso, the most prestigious builder in the area in 2009. The collaboration of traditional skills with years of experience in the Indonesian live-a-board diving industry has created a remarkable vessel.
DAMAI I has been designed to offer a personal service dedicated to small groups. With an overall length of 130 feet and a beam of over 26 feet the vessel has 7 staterooms with a choice of single cabins, twins, doubles or two spacious master cabins. With sizes ranging from 194 sq feet for the single cabin to 430 sq feet for the master cabin, all are furnished with either queen- or king-sized beds, en-suite toilets, and showers.
The vessel has been designed with three large deck areas for relaxing in sun or shade and enjoying rejuvenating massage and spa treatments. Specifically designed for divers, the vessel offers large dive stations with individual rinse tanks, a camera room with separate workstations, and an integrated 110v and 220v charging station for each photographer.
The vessel is the first in Indonesia to offer 3 dive guides and 1 Instructor on board throughout your trip. With only 12 guests on most trips and 14 on some (full boat charter only), this is a good 4:1 guest to dive guide ratio. They also have 2 custom designed high speed tender boats used to transfer guests to and from the dive site safely and comfortably.
